The Shimmering Oasis in the Desert
No discussion of casinos is complete without mentioning Las Vegas. This desert city has become a global symbol of 24/7 excitement and luxury.
Bellagio Hotel & Casino: Known worldwide for its spectacular fountain show, fine art collection, and high-stakes poker action. The Legendary Caesars Palace: A true Vegas icon, its Roman-inspired architecture has hosted countless stars and casino events. The Venetian Resort: Guests can experience a slice of Venice, from its architecture to its famous canals.
The Playground of the Rich and Famous
The vibe in Monte Carlo is one of historic grandeur and elite society. The Casino de Monte-Carlo is arguably the most beautiful and famous casino in the world. This historic establishment, with its opulent decor, casino has been immortalized in cinema, forever linked with the debonair spy, James Bond.
The Las Vegas of Asia
The title of the world's biggest gambling hub now belongs to Macau. This former Portuguese colony now generates more gambling income than Las Vegas, thanks to its proximity to the vast Asian market. The venues are colossal, and the action is centered on the high-limit baccarat tables. These giant integrated resorts offer a unique entertainment experience that is both grand and culturally diverse.
